Q2 2026 earnings summary

31 Jul, 2026

Executive summary

  • Consolidated sales rose 3.9% year-over-year to MXN 48.2 million, despite adverse FX effects from peso appreciation.

  • Net income increased 10.6% year-over-year to MXN 3 million, with EBITDA at MXN 7.2 million, down 15.7% due to prior-year extraordinary gains.

  • Major acquisitions in hydrocarbons included agreements to acquire a 30% stake in Block 30 and an additional 5% in the Zama oil field.

  • Completed sale of Keystone Cement for ~$310 million, with 55% of proceeds to subsidiaries.

  • Zamajal and Grupo Sanborns divisions led revenue growth for the quarter.

Financial highlights

  • Operating income was MXN 5.1 million, down from MXN 6.4 million last year due to prior-year extraordinary gains; adjusted, operating income rose ~1%.

  • EBITDA margin declined to 14.9% from 18.4% in Q2 2025.

  • Comprehensive financing result improved 72% year-over-year, with a cost of MXN 597 million.

  • Net debt stood at MXN 16.9 million; net-debt-to-LTM EBITDA ratio at 0.69x.

  • Grupo Sanborns revenue grew 8.4% to MXN 17.8 million; operating income up 11.4% to MXN 806 million.

Outlook and guidance

  • Production at Ichalkil and Pokoch fields expected to improve with full operation of Fieldwood.

  • Backlog in infrastructure and hydrocarbons segments increased significantly, supporting future revenue streams.

  • Ongoing construction of Centauro del Norte Pipeline and expansion in hydrocarbons portfolio expected to drive growth.
